Airport Overview
John F. Kennedy International Airport (JFK) is a key aviation facility serving the region of New York City, United States. It is officially identified by the IATA code JFK and ICAO code KJFK. The airport is situated at an elevation of 13 feet (4 meters) above mean sea level. It operates within the America/New_York timezone, allowing travelers to synchronize their flight itineraries accordingly. The airfield configuration consists of 4 runways, designed to accommodate various types of aircraft operations. Nearby alternative gateways include LaGuardia Airport (LGA) and Newark Liberty International Airport (EWR), which can be considered for regional or international transit.
